Waitrose Foundation At Work

Community Building Activities support sport and cultural activities at Morester Farm, Piketberg

October 2022

Due to the remote location of farm worker accommodation in the community, challenges faced by workers and their families often relate to the lack of access to transport for the youth as well as sports facilities.

The negative impact of loadshedding in areas not reached by the farm's generators was also a significant concern and the worker community opted to purchase gas stoves with allocated Waitrose Foundation funds. The stoves are being used for home cooking, especially during loadshedding.

Other projects that funds were used for included the purchasing of rugby kit for the group of men participating in sports. Sport events bring the community together, and are an important part of relaxing and constructive activities over weekends. A total of 71 people directly benefit from these projects at Morester (20 men, 39 women, and 12 youth).  We look forward to checking in again with the team at Morester early in 2023.
